What are the Benefits of Adding Bee Pollen to Smoothies?

Bee pollen boasts an impressive nutritional profile. It's a complete protein source, meaning it contains all nine essential amino acids our bodies can't produce on their own. Beyond protein, it's rich in vitamins (like B vitamins, vitamin C, and vitamin E), minerals (including calcium, magnesium, and zinc), and antioxidants that combat free radical damage. Adding it to your smoothie provides a convenient way to harness these benefits. Many people report increased energy levels and improved immune function after incorporating bee pollen into their diet.

Is Bee Pollen Safe for Everyone?

While generally safe for consumption, it's crucial to be mindful. Bee pollen is a potent allergen, so individuals with pollen allergies should exercise extreme caution and potentially avoid it altogether. Start with a small amount to assess any potential reactions before increasing your intake. If you have any concerns, consult with your doctor or allergist before adding bee pollen to your diet.

What are the side effects of bee pollen?

Some individuals may experience mild side effects like upset stomach or allergic reactions (itching, swelling, difficulty breathing). These reactions are more likely in those with pre-existing allergies. Always start with a small quantity and monitor your body's response. If you experience any adverse effects, discontinue use and seek medical advice.

How much bee pollen should I use in a smoothie?

A typical serving size is 1-2 teaspoons per day. Begin with a smaller amount (½ teaspoon) to gauge your tolerance before gradually increasing. The taste is quite subtle and earthy, so you won't necessarily taste a strong bee pollen flavor in your smoothie.

Can I add bee pollen to smoothies every day?

Yes, provided you don't experience any negative side effects. Consistent consumption allows you to reap the ongoing health benefits of this nutrient-dense ingredient. However, remember to maintain a balanced diet and lifestyle to optimize your overall well-being.

Delicious Bee Pollen Smoothie Recipes:

Here are three unique smoothie recipes incorporating the delightful benefits of bee pollen:

Tropical Bee Pollen Bliss:

  • 1 cup frozen mango chunks
  • ½ cup frozen pineapple chunks
  • ½ cup coconut water
  • 1 tablespoon bee pollen
  • ½ teaspoon ginger (optional)

Instructions: Combine all ingredients in a blender and blend until smooth. Adjust liquid as needed for desired consistency.

Green Powerhouse with Bee Pollen:

  • 1 cup spinach
  • ½ cup frozen berries (mixed berries work well)
  • ½ banana
  • ½ cup almond milk
  • 1 tablespoon bee pollen
  • 1 tablespoon chia seeds (optional)

Instructions: Blend all ingredients until smooth and creamy. Add more almond milk if necessary for desired consistency.

Berry Bee Pollen Blast:

  • 1 cup frozen mixed berries
  • ½ cup plain Greek yogurt
  • ¼ cup orange juice
  • 1 tablespoon bee pollen
  • A few drops of vanilla extract (optional)

Instructions: Combine all ingredients in a blender and blend until smooth and creamy. The Greek yogurt adds a lovely thickness to this smoothie.
